Summary

Collinder 316 is a moderately populated, very dense object of very high C3 quality. It is located at a relatively close distance from the Sun, above the mid-plane. It is rarely studied in the literature, with no articles listed in the last 22 years.

This is likely a unique object, which shares a moderate percentage of members with at least one previously reported entry.
